About Zbigniew Preisner
Zbigniew Preisner, born Zbigniew Kowalski, is a renowned Polish composer celebrated for his evocative film scores and symphonic works. His international acclaim stems largely from his collaborations with the esteemed director Krzysztof Kieślowski, for whom he created some of his most memorable compositions. Preisner's music is known for its emotional depth and haunting beauty, often blending classical and contemporary elements to create a unique sonic landscape. Beyond his film work, Preisner has also composed for theater and television, amassing a discography that spans over 50 projects. His pieces, such as "Lamento per Europa" and "Sospensione," showcase his mastery of orchestration and his ability to evoke profound emotions. Preisner's contributions to cinema have earned him numerous accolades, including César, Silver Bear, and Golden Globe nominations, cementing his status as one of the most outstanding film composers of his generation. His music continues to inspire and captivate audiences worldwide, making him a pivotal figure in the realm of contemporary film scoring.
